Winter Months Weather Considerations
When winter season rolls in, exactly how prepared is your roof covering for the obstacles it brings? Snow, ice, and freezing temperature levels can take a toll on your roofing's stability.
First, check for any type of existing damage before the cool embed in. Seek missing tiles, cracks, or leaks; resolving these issues now can conserve you from pricey repairs later on.
Next, think about the weight of snow. Buildup can lead to sagging and even architectural failing. If you live in an area prone to heavy snowfall, it's wise to purchase a roofing rake. Frequently getting rid of snow off your roof helps protect against these problems.
After that, focus on your gutters. Clogged up seamless gutters can bring about ice dams, triggering water to back up and possibly permeate into your home. Ensure your seamless gutters are clean and without debris to promote appropriate drain.
Last but not least, inspect your attic room for proper insulation and air flow. A well-insulated attic room assists avoid warm loss, lowering the opportunities of ice formation on your roof covering.

Summertime and Autumn Preparations
As the summertime sunlight blazes and leaves begin to change, it's important to prepare your roofing for the forthcoming months.
Start by evaluating your roof covering for any type of damages triggered by the extreme sunlight or tornados. Look for cracked tiles, loosened tiles, or any kind of indicators of wear. Do not fail to remember to examine your rain gutters; they need to be clear of debris to make certain appropriate drainage during fall rainfalls.
Next off, take into consideration applying a protective finish to your roof. This can help show the sun's rays, safeguarding your tiles from UV damage.
If you have trees near your home, trim branches that might fall or rub against your roof in tornados.
As loss strategies, keep an eye on the leaves. Accumulation can trap moisture, leading to mold and mildew and rot. On a regular basis removing your roofing system and seamless gutters will certainly aid avoid these issues.
Lastly, schedule an expert assessment if you observe any type of considerable damage or if you simply desire assurance.
Taking these proactive actions will certainly make certain that your roofing system remains solid and sturdy via the summer warmth and fall rains, conserving you from costly repair work down the line.
